A word of caution, driving along in a thunder storm 2 nights ago and felt a drop of water hit my hand, strange i thought is my sunroof leaking? Automatic reaction was to put my finger to my mouth No it wasn't water but the most disgusting burning fluid imaginable. Yes you might have guessed, my autodip rear view mirror had broken dripping its guts out. Only an hour before i'd noticed it wasn't dimming properly. So if you notice your mirror isn't dimming get it off your screen as quick as you can don't wait like me and keep your fingers away from your mouth, just like your mum used to tell you Mum knows best!
